Okinawan traditional pottery, "yachimun," is made by firing clay twice—once it is bisque-fired and then glazed—to create beautiful colors and a unique texture. In this experience, you will use an electric potter's wheel to shape the clay into a vessel.
Experience making Yachimun pottery at a small workshop on Yagaji Island in northern Okinawa Prefecture. Your creations are perfect for everyday use and make wonderful gifts. Enjoy the joy of crafting and experience a precious moment immersed in Okinawan culture.
